First look production images are released for Atri Banerjee’s highly acclaimed production of Tennessee Williams’ The Glass Menagerie, which was first seen at Royal Exchange Theatre in late 2022, opened at Belgrade Theatre on 16 – 23 March, now playing Malvern Festival Theatre, before moving on to Rose Theatre, Bristol Old Vic, Theatre Royal Bath and Alexandra Palace through late spring.

Tom escapes a suffocating home life through cigarettes and long visits to the movies while his sister, Laura, withdraws into her records and collection of glass animals. But their mother, Amanda, harbours dreams for them far beyond their shabby apartment. When Tom brings home a potential suitor for Laura, Amanda seizes the opportunity to try and change their fortunes forever. Banerjee’s acclaimed production reimagines Williams’ semi-autobiographical masterpiece, exploring the intimacy and intensity of the complex web of love and loyalty that binds families together.

The full cast is Geraldine Somerville (Cracker, Gosford Park, and the Harry Potter film series) reprising her portrayal of Amanda Wingfield, who is joined by new cast members Kasper Hilton-Hille (Tom Wingfield), Zacchaeus Kayode (Jim O’Connor), and Natalie Kimmerling (Laura Wingfield).
